What color is 19FFAC?

The RGB color code for color number #19FFAC is RGB(25, 255, 172). In the RGB color model, #19FFAC has a red value of 25, a green value of 255, and a blue value of 172. The CMYK color model (also known as process color, used in color printing) comprises 90.2% cyan, 0.0% magenta, 32.5% yellow, and 0.0% key (black). The HSL color scale has a hue of 158.3° (degrees), 100.0 % saturation, and 54.9 % lightness. In the HSB/HSV color space, #19FFAC has a hue of 158.3° (degrees), 90.2 % saturation and 100.0 % brightness/value.

What is the LRV of 19FFAC?

Color code 19FFAC has an LRV of nearly 75. By LRV value, it is a light color.
Light Reflectance Value (LRV), indicates how light or dark a color will look on a scale of 0 (black) to 100 (white).

Monochromatic Color Palette

Monochromatic colors belong to the same hue angle but different tints and shades. Monochromatic color palette can be generated by keeping the exact hue of the base color and then changing the saturation and lightness.

Analogous Color Palette

Analogous colors are a group of colors adjacent to each other on a color wheel. Group of these adjacent colors forms Analogous color scheme Palette. Analogous Palette can be generated by increasing or decreasing the hue value by 30 points.

Triadic Color Palette

The triadic color palette has three colors separated by 120° in the RGB color wheel

Tetradic Color Palette

The tetradic colour scheme composed of two sets of complementary colors in a rectangular shape on the color wheel.
